{"data":{"id":"us-ky/krs-216b.061","jurisdiction":"us-ky","citation":"KRS 216B.061","heading":"Actions requiring certificates of need -- Prohibitions against dividing","body":"projects to evade expenditure minimums and against ex parte contacts --\nAmbulatory surgical centers.\n(1) Unless otherwise provided in this chapter, no person shall do any of the following\nwithout first obtaining a certificate of need:\n(a) Establish a health facility;\n(b) Obligate a capital expenditure which exceeds the capital expenditure\nminimum;\n(c) Make a substantial change in the bed capacity of a health facility;\n(d) Make a substantial change in a health service;\n(e) Make a substantial change in a project;\n(f) Acquire major medical equipment;\n(g) Increase a geographical area or alter a specific location which has been\ndesignated on a certificate of need or license; or\n(h) Transfer an approved certificate of need for the establishment of a new health\nfacility or the replacement of a licensed facility.\n(2) No person shall separate portions of a single project into components in order to\nevade any expenditure minimum se t forth in this chapter. For purposes of this\nchapter, the acquisition of one (1) or more items of functionally related diagnostic\nor therapeutic equipment shall be considered as one (1) project.\n(3) No person shall have ex parte contact with the final -decision-making authority\nengaged in certificate of need activities regarding a certificate -of-need application\nfrom the commencement of the review cycle to the final decision. If an ex parte\ncontact occurs, it shall be promptly made a part of the record.\n(4) No person shall obligate a capital expenditure in excess of the amount authorized\nby an existing certificate of need unless the person has received an administrative\nescalation from the cabinet as prescribed by regulation.\n(5) No person shall proceed to obligate a capital expenditure under an approved\ncertificate of need if there has been a substantial change in the project.\n(6) A certificate of need shall be issued for a specific location and, when applicable, for\na designated geographical area.\n(7) No person shall establish an ambulatory surgical center as defined in KRS\n216B.015 without obtaining a certificate of need. An ambulatory surgical center\nshall require a certificate of need and license, no twithstanding any exemption\ncontained in KRS 216B.020.\n(8) Nothing in this chapter shall be interpreted to require any ambulatory surgical\ncenter licensed as of July 12, 2012, to obtain a certificate of need to continue\noperations and exercise all of the r ights of a licensed health care facility, regardless\nof whether it obtained a certificate of need before being licensed.","path":["KRS Chapter 216B"],"source_url":"https://apps.legislature.ky.gov/law/statutes/statute.aspx?id=57608","current_through":"Includes enactments through the 2026 Regular Session","vintage":"09/05/2026","retrieved_at":"2026-09-05T20:52:23Z","sha256":"76440db321d6b2d8dbc4cf9173b12c3cc5333c00d289d5c010034bd6b0f38688","source_id":"us-ky","stale":false,"prev":"us-ky/krs-216b.060","next":"us-ky/krs-216b.0615"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
